Use our handy brick calculators to easily work out how many bricks you need for your job

Important: These will tell you the exact number you need for a single skin wall. We always recommend you actually order at least 5-10% more than this to allow for a small amount of damages, cuts and wastage.

FAQs

When Will Delivery Be?

For orders of palletised goods earliest available delivery is usually 2 or 3 working days from the time an order is placed, although in some circumstances can be longer. During the checkout process you will be able to select a delivery date from the earliest available to up to 2 weeks onward. Our standard service is a non-timed delivery between 8am and 5.30pm on the arranged day.

Other orders will display estimated dispatch and delivery times upon checkout.

How Are Packs Delivered?

Deliveries are usually made with an 18 ton rigid wagon and the driver will unload using a tail lift and manual pump truck. Deliveries will be made to the kerbside or the bottom of the driveway.

What If I Receive Damaged Goods?

Whilst we do our utmost to ensure your goods arrive in perfect condition, it is important to allow a total of 7.5% for cuts, wastage and for a small number of potential breakages when ordering.

We always check each crate before it is dispatched but if you do find any problem with your order or even have any suspicion of damage, please sign for goods as damaged. We will also require photographs of the damages. We will then be able to arrange replacements or refund.

Can I Return A Product?

You can return any product purchased from Ammaari Stones, subject to the conditions stated in our return policy which can be seen at https://ammaaristones.co.uk/terms-and-conditions/.

Where Are You Located?

Our main offices are in Preston. Our goods are stored in a few different locations, mainly in the Ipswich area. We do not currently have a showroom.

Does Someone Need To Be Present For The Delivery?

For orders of packs we require you, or someone that you have authorised, to be present to check that the delivery is as expected, undamaged and to sign for the delivery.

In general samples will be delivered through your mailbox and no-one needs to be present.

Can You Deliver To This Address?

We can deliver to any area in the UK. For standard deliveries there needs to be enough room for an 18 ton rigid wagon to manoeuvre and for the driver to pull the pallet on to the kerb from the road.

Standard delivery is by manual pump truck and tail-lift. Delivery can only be made to a flat, solid surface. Deliveries cannot be made on grass or gravel.

If you are unsure whether your address is suitable please contact us at 01772 369007 or info@ammaaristones.co.uk and we will help advise you.

Will The Appearance Vary From The Pictures/Photos?

As we supply natural products colour varies throughout the product so samples and pictures should only be used as a general guide of colour.

Do You Offer Split Packs?

In our paving range we are currently only able to offer full packs.

In some cases we are able to offer split packs of bricks. For bricks where this is available there will be a drop-down menu on the product page for you to select quantity of bricks in multiples of 50.

Can You Provide An Estimated Time Of Arrival?

As we use 3rd party delivery companies, unfortunately we are unable to provide an exact ETA; goods may arrive at any time between 8am and 5.30pm on the arranged day so you need to make sure that somebody is present to check the delivery and sign for it.

We ask the delivery company to give you a call an hour or two in advance of their arrival.
